Transfer insights for Atlanta International Airport

Hartsfield-Jackson operates two terminals: the Domestic Terminal on the west side serves all US flights, while the International Terminal on the east side handles international arrivals. Passengers clearing US Customs and Border Protection collect checked baggage at the arrivals level and exit into the lower-level roadway where ground transport departs. The driver meets you at the arrivals baggage-hall exit holding a name sign, with no designated desk or counter — simply follow baggage-claim signage to street level.

From ATL to downtown Atlanta, the distance is approximately 11 km via Interstate 75 north or Interstate 285 eastbound. Under normal traffic, door-to-door takes 20–25 minutes, but rush hours (7–9 AM and 4:30–7 PM on weekdays) routinely add 15–30 minutes to any journey. Bottlenecks form on I-75 north towards the Connector and on I-285 near the airport interchange, particularly during afternoon peak when regional traffic converges. Morning congestion typically clears by 10 AM; evening congestion persists until 7:30 PM.

Georgia's Express Lanes run on select routes including I-75 corridors and offer a paid option to bypass congestion; however, all tolls and lane charges are included in your fixed Transfeero price at no extra cost. There are no low-emission zones in the Atlanta metropolitan area. Your pre-booked transfer price covers all applicable road charges in full, with zero hidden fees or surprise tolls.

Atlanta's licensed taxi rank charges a fixed $37.50 flat rate to downtown but queues regularly exceed 30 minutes, especially during peak arrivals; MARTA rail to Five Points costs $2.50 but requires handling luggage through busy stations; Uber and Lyft surge 40–60% during peak hours and unpredictable surge pricing applies. A pre-booked private transfer offers a confirmed price, door-to-door convenience, and a driver who monitors your flight in real time and adjusts for delays automatically.
